It is vital to reconstruct a three-dimensional terrain by a few sparse points in the digital elevation model (DEM). However, the reconstructed surfaces from elementary functions(e.g. lines and cubics) appear too smooth to represent a terrain with self-affinity property. This paper evaluated the capability of FLAASH in ENVI software to make atmospheric correction for Hyperion hyperspectral image and ALI image. Hyperion and ALI sensors are two of the three instruments onboard NASA EO-1 satellite, New Millennium Program (NMP) launched on November 21, 2000, and Hyperion is the first spaceborne hyperspectral imaging spectrometer.
